Permit Update
The Type 1 Land Use Permit has been submitted to Washington County. This permit is for formal approval of Village's Phase 1 Development Plan—as modified. A decision should be forthcoming from Washington County in 4-6 weeks.
Design Update
The Architects continue work on the interior design. Several meetings are now occurring on the platform design, childcare center and decorating schemes throughout the new Worship Center. Acoustical, A/V and Lighting are also a focus of their work.
Estimated Timeline
The project is on schedule. Work is progressing on the final design with bids going out in May and groundbreaking planned for this July.
Estimated Budget
The total estimated project budget is from $11.6 to $12.8 million. This budget includes all design, demolition, construction, permit fees, escalation, contingency and special equipment costs. To date estimated costs are within budget at $11.6 million.
Worship Center Project Overview
Ground Floor — 9,720 square feet
- 1 toddler and 2 nursery rooms with 62 person +/- capacity
- 3 multi-use classrooms with 200+/- person capacity
- Entry lobby, restrooms and elevator
Main Floor — 23,525 square feet
- Flat floor Sanctuary with 800-1000 seating capacity
- Lobby including fireplace, coffee station, & conversational seating
- 2 multi-use classrooms with 140+ person capacity
- Cry & translation rooms, A/V/Lighting booth, support, mechanical & storage rooms, restrooms and elevator
- Plaza area between existing and new sanctuary with covered walkways, garden landscaping and outside seating
Future 3rd Floor — 10,000 square feet of expansion area
- Balcony with 300+ seating capacity and
- 2 multi-use classrooms with 150+ person capacity, or
- Large meeting space, offices, etc.
- Small lobby, restrooms and elevator
